Wood cladding replacement services involve removing old, damaged, or deteriorating wooden exterior panels and installing new, durable wood cladding to enhance the appearance and protection of a property. This process typically includes carefully removing the existing cladding, inspecting the underlying structure for any issues, and then fitting new wooden panels that match the style and design of the building. Skilled contractors ensure that the new cladding is properly secured and sealed to prevent water infiltration and improve the overall integrity of the exterior. This service is essential for homeowners seeking to refresh the look of their property or address issues caused by aging or weather damage.
One of the primary reasons homeowners seek wood cladding replacement is to solve problems related to weathering, rot, or insect damage. Over time, exposure to the elements can cause wooden panels to warp, crack, or decay, leading to a less appealing appearance and potential structural concerns. In some cases, old cladding may become loose or develop gaps that allow moisture to penetrate, which can result in mold or further damage to the underlying structure. Replacing worn or damaged wood helps restore the property’s exterior, providing a more attractive and weather-resistant finish that protects the building for years to come.

The overview below groups typical Wood Cladding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Somerville, MA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or wood cladding repairs or patchwork in Somerville range from $250 to $600. Many routine maintenance projects fall within this range, depending on the extent of damage and material used.
Partial Replacement - Replacing sections of wood cladding usually costs between $1,000 and $3,000. Local contractors often handle these projects, which can vary based on the size and type of wood involved.
Full Cladding Replacement - Complete replacement of wood cladding generally ranges from $5,000 to $15,000. Larger, more complex projects or premium materials can push costs higher, but most fall within this typical band.
Custom or Extensive Projects - Extensive or custom wood cladding work, such as on large commercial buildings or historic restorations, can reach $20,000 or more. These projects are less common and tend to involve specialized materials and labor.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is involved in replacing wood cladding? Replacing wood cladding typically includes removing the existing material, preparing the surface, and installing new wood or alternative siding options, ensuring proper attachment and finish.
How can I tell if my wood cladding needs replacement? Signs such as rotting, warping, cracking, or extensive water damage indicate that replacement may be necessary to maintain the structure’s integrity.
What types of materials are used for wood cladding replacement? Common options include natural wood species, composite materials, or engineered sidings designed to mimic the appearance of traditional wood.
Are there different styles available for wood cladding replacement? Yes, local contractors can install various styles such as horizontal, vertical, shiplap, or board-and-batten to match or update the building’s aesthetic.
